What Would You Give Up or Do Differently If You Had to Lower Monthly Expenses? (50 Ideas!)
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on LInkedIn


Looking for creative ways to lower your monthly expenses? This list might give you some inspiration and ideas to try! (Find even more great ideas here!)

If you were forced to lower your monthly expenses with no way to increase your income, what would you give up first? Here’s what many of our readers had to say when we posed the question on Facebook!

50 Ways to Easily Lower Your Monthly Expenses

FOOD to GIVE UP:

Restaurants and fast food! (NOTE: this was the top answer from hundreds of readers!)

Hot lunch (pack lunches from home instead).

Coffee runs (just make it at home).

Starbucks.

Ice Cream.

Meat.

Organic foods. (Or find ways to save on them.)

Brand name foods — store bought is usually just as good.

Grocery splurges & impulse purchases — get more intentional about menu planning.

Grocery shopping (for a week or two by using up things in your pantry and freezer).

Individually packaged items — buy in bulk to save instead.

Individual drinks — canned soda, Gatorade, sparkling waters, lemonade, etc.

Alcohol and soda — at the grocery store and restaurants.

Junk food, desserts, and treats.

Vending machine snacks.

MONTHLY BILLS to ELIMINATE:

Streaming services (try FREE Sling TV instead!) and digital subscriptions (NOTE: this was the next most popular answer!)

Cell phone data usage.

Cell phone company — switch to one with a lower rate.

Gym membership.

Amazon Prime.

Magazine and newspaper subscriptions.

Cable TV or Satellite Dish.

Pet grooming — watch a YouTube video and do it at home.

Manicures & Pedicures — Do it yourself at home.

Delivery fees — only get things with free shipping.

Insurance on household appliances — it’s usually not worth it.

Utilities — intentionally lower your heating bill or call the companies to negotiate a lower rate.

HABITS to CHANGE:

Stop paying full price for anything!

Try shopping for groceries at outside-the-box places.

Stop traveling (at least for a year or so). Or check out these travel savings tips.

Stop buying anything you don’t have room in your budget for (pay cash for everything).

Color your own hair.

Hang clothes on a clothesline to dry instead of using the dryer.

Say no to impulse purchases.

Switch to free/frugal entertainment like going for a walk with friends or having people over instead of going out.

Stop online browsing that turns into shopping or impulse buys.

Turn thermostat down/up and unplug devices when not in use.

Hunt, fish, and grow a garden.

Utilize free cycle sites for clothes and toys.

Walk or ride your bike instead of driving everywhere.

Give up some of the kids’ extracurricular activities and sports.

Conserve gas by running all errands in one day instead of several times a week.

Thrift and shop ahead.

Learn to wait 24 hours before making a purchase.

Scale back on ALL holiday spending (food, entertainment, gifts, clothing, decorations, etc.).

Increase giving to those in worse need to help change your perspective.

Focus more on needs versus wants.

Make a budget and actually stick with it!

Try cheap and free date night ideas.

Recognize items you might not have to buy.

Discover the joy of contentment.
